Organic Sales Decline and Market Performance:
- reported a 4.2% decline in organic sales for Q2 2025, with global consumption growing year-over-year but outpacing organic sales across each segment.
- The decline was primarily due to execution issues, soft allergy and sun care seasons in key markets, and strategic price investments in the U.S.

Segment Performance Variability:
- The Self Care segment saw a 5.9% contraction in organic sales, although consumption grew year-over-year. In contrast, Essential Health performed well in Latin America but faced declines in other regions.
- The variations were attributed to seasonal and inventory dynamics, competitive pressures, and strategic pricing adjustments.

Leadership Changes and Strategic Review:
- Kirk L. Perry was appointed as interim CEO, and Amit Banati joined as the new CFO, marking significant leadership changes.
- A comprehensive review of strategic alternatives, including optimizing the brand portfolio, is underway, with a focus on unlocking shareholder value and improving operational performance.

Strategic Initiatives and Market Focus:
- Kenvue plans to strengthen leadership and capabilities, with four new leaders joining the team in the past three months.
- The company is focused on reducing complexity, improving execution, and making choices on where to play and how to win, especially with its top brands and markets.

Financial Outlook and Margin Challenges:
- Adjusted operating margin contracted 10 basis points to 22.7%, with a revised outlook for 2025 expecting organic sales to be down low single digits.
- The margin decline was due to strategic price investments, fixed cost deleverage, and inflationary pressures, with efforts to offset these through productivity initiatives.
